SITUATION: Crowborough town itself provides an excellent range of shopping facilities including a post office, doctors, dentists and supermarkets including a Waitrose and Morrisons together with an array of independent shops and retailers. The main line railway station at nearby Jarvis Brook provides trains to London Bridge and benefits also include a good selection of bus routes. The area is well served for both state and private junior and secondary schooling with sporting and recreational facilities including golf at Crowborough Beacon and Boars Head Courses, Crowborough Tennis & Squash Club and the Crowborough Leisure Centre with indoor swimming pool. Located to the west of Crowborough and made famous by A A Milne's Winnie the Pooh, is Ashdown Forest which is a great place for walking, riding and enjoying spectacular views over the Sussex countryside. The spa town of Royal Tunbridge Wells is approximately eight miles to the north where you will find the mainline railway station, good range of grammar schools and an excellent mix of retailers, eateries and pavement cafes spread through the historic Pantiles and The Old High Street. The coastal towns of Brighton and Eastbourne are situated approximately one hour's drive away and Gatwick Airport can be reached in approximately 45 minutes by car.
